Job description

Applies the tools developed in his or her own recovery as well as the philosophy and values of Intentional Peer Support to build a connection, consider world view, maintain mutuality, and move towards a new way of being within the new relationship being built with the individual. The Intentional Peer Support Specialist - Integrated will collaborate, coach, and challenge individuals in viewing life’s challenges as an opportunity for growth and change within each individual’s recovery process.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Fully understands and is able to actively implement the three principles and four tasks of Intentional Peer Support.
  • Models relationship building, based on the four tasks of intentional peer support, with participants, volunteers and colleagues.
  • Understands and actively implements the Eight Dimensions of Wellness as described by SAMHSA.
  • Models the attributes of respect, trust, sensitivity and confidentiality.
  • Supports and models healthy relationships.

EDUCATION:

  • High School diploma or equivalent.

C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S REQUIRED:

  • State of Maine Certified Intentional Peer Support Specialist (CIPSS) Certification; or
  • Working towards the CIPSS certification; and
  • Complete the CIPSS pre-training within the first thirty (30) calendar days of hire;
  • Attend monthly co-reflections within sixty (60) calendar days of hire; and
  • Attend CIPSS 101 and apply for the next available Core Training within ninety (90) calendar days of hire.
  • Meet the annual State of Maine requirements to maintain CIPSS Certification.
  • Staff must maintain a valid state driver’s license, reliable transportation and adequate insurance.
  • Certified Residential Medication Aide (CRMA) preferred for the ACT team.

EXPERIENCE:

  • Knowledge gained by lived experience with the process of Recovery from trauma, serious mental illness, and/or co-occurring Substance Use Disorder (SUD) and is willing to self-identify with peers on this basis in the community.
  • Paid, or unpaid, peer support experience preferred.

KNOWLEDGE AND SKILLS:

  • Demonstrates knowledge of personal Recovery.
  • Ability to be “emotionally present”; recognize when you are not, seek support, and communicate this to the assigned manager.
  • Ability to work with diverse populations and accept differences in perspective and values.
  • Intermediate computer skills including the expectation of utilizing Electronic Health Record software.
